DATA SHEET GBJ8A~GBJ8K
GLASS PASSIVATED SINGLE-PHASE BRIDGE RECTIFIER VOLTAGE - 50 to 800 Volts CURRENT - 8.0 Amperes

NOTES: 1. Recommended mounting position is to bolt down on heatsink with silicone thermal compound for maximum heat transfer with #6 screw. 2. Units Mounted in free air, no heatsink, P.C.B at 0.375"(9.5mm) lead length with 0.5 x 0.5"(12 x 12mm)copper pads. 3. Units Mounted on a 3.0 x 3.0" x 0.11" thick ( 7.5 x 7.5 x 0.3cm) AL plate.
